Time Limits

In a number of states, asbestos law; similar web site, victims have a limited time to file mesothelioma lawsuits. These laws are known as statutes of limitations and they establish deadlines for filing a personal injury or wrongful death claim. A mesothelioma lawyer can help patients and their families determine the statute of limitations that applies to their specific case. The statute of limitations applicable to your case can depend on a range of factors, including the victim's places of residence and work. It could also differ based on where the asbestos exposure occurred, and which asbestos companies or work sites are involved.

Typically, the statute of limitations "clock" starts when a person realized or should have known that their exposure to asbestos caused serious injuries. In mesothelioma cases, this is usually the date of diagnosis. However, in certain circumstances, the clock may start earlier. The clock may begin earlier, for instance, if the patient suffers from a chronic condition like asthma, which requires constant medication and limits their activity.

If a mesothelioma patient or a family member dies before the statute of limitation has expired, the estate can still file for compensation against the parties responsible. These claims are typically granted to pay funeral expenses as well as lost income and the pain and discomfort that has occurred in the past.

A mesothelioma lawyer in the United States can assist you in filing claims for compensation through the asbestos trust fund. Asbestos companies found responsible for asbestos case exposure reorganized under Chapter 11 bankruptcy law and established trusts to pay mesothelioma victims. A kn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er has a database of these trust funds and can help you file an action for compensation.
